Going into the rental, I was familiar with Economy having used them previously and thought it okay enough to return, based primarily on the rate and the previous experience. The car I received was perfect. It was what I rented and was clean and ran very well. Here's where the "other shoe" drops. I purchased the collision insurance offered when I rented the vehicle, really just as a back up. I planned on self-insuring the rental on my personal policy like I have done multiple times before. Just to be prepared, I brought a copy of my policy for the agent to see if there was any questions that required documentation. First, she told me that the extra insurance that I purchased at the point of rental was not good enough. Then I showed my policy to her, when she told me that their vehicle wasn't covered on my policy. Being stuck and needing to get where I was going, I relented and paid for their insurance. In the end, the insurance was twice the cost of the full rental. Had I realized that this was going to be the case, I'd have gone with one of the bigger agencies that do have on-site access. Just buyer beware.

FAQs about renting a car from Economy Rent a Car

  • How much does it cost to rent a car from Economy Rent a Car?

    On average a rental car from Economy Rent a Car costs S$ 84 per day.

  • What is the most popular rental car from Economy Rent a Car?

  • How many car rental locations does Economy Rent a Car have?

    Economy Rent a Car has 222 car hire locations worldwide. Take a look at our Economy Rent a Car car hire location map to find the best car near you.

  • Which countries does Economy Rent a Car have rental car locations in?

    Albania, Argentina, Aruba, Australia, Barbados, Bolivia, Brazil, Bulgaria, Canada, Chile, Colombia, Costa Rica, Croatia, Curaçao, Cyprus, Dominican Republic, El Salvador, Greece, Grenada, Guadeloupe, Guam, Guatemala, Guyana, Honduras, Iceland, Italy, Jamaica, Jordan, Malta, Martinique, Mexico, Morocco, New Zealand, Nicaragua, Panama, Paraguay, Poland, Portugal, Puerto Rico, Romania, Russia, Saint Barthélemy, Saint Martin, Saint Vincent and the Grenadines, South Africa, Spain, St. Maarten, Suriname, Switzerland, Trinidad and Tobago, Turkey, Turks and Caicos Islands, U.S. Virgin Islands, United States and Uruguay

  • How much does it cost to rent a car from Economy Rent a Car for a week?

    On average a rental car from Economy Rent a Car costs S$ 591 per week (S$ 84 per day).

  • How much does it cost to rent a car from Economy Rent a Car long term for a month?

    On average a rental car from Economy Rent a Car costs S$ 2,535 per month (S$ 84 per day).
